WebAudioContext class
Constructors
- WebAudioContext.new({JSObject? $$context$$})
Properties
- $$context$$ ↔ JSObject
-
getter/setter pair
- currentTime ↔ num
-
getter/setter pair
- destination ↔ WebAudioContextNode
-
getter/setter pair
- hashCode → int
-
The hash code for this object.
no setterinherited
- listener ↔ AudioListener
-
getter/setter pair
- onstatechange ↔ dynamic
-
getter/setter pair
- runtimeType → Type
-
A representation of the runtime type of the object.
no setterinherited
- sampleRate ↔ num
-
getter/setter pair
- state ↔ String
-
getter/setter pair
Methods
-
close(
) → dynamic -
createAnalyser(
) → AnalyserNode -
createBiquadFilter(
) → BiquadFilterNode -
createBuffer(
num numOfChannels, num length, num sampleRate) → AudioBuffer -
createBufferSource(
) → BufferSourceNode -
createChannelMerger(
num numberOfInputs) → ChannelMergerNode -
createChannelSplitter(
num numberOfOutputs) → ChannelSplitterNode -
createConstantSource(
) → ConstantSourceNode -
createDelay(
num maxDelayTime) → DelayNode -
createDynamicsCompressor(
) → DynamicsCompressorNode -
createGain(
) → GainNode -
createIIRFilter(
List< num> feedforward, List<num> feedback) → IIRFilterNode -
createOscillator(
) → OscillatorNode -
createPanner(
) → PannerNode -
createPeriodicWave(
Float32Array real, Float32Array imag, Constraints constraints) → PeriodicWaveNode -
createScriptProcessor(
num bufferSize, num numberOfInputChannels, num numberOfOutputChannels) → ScriptProcessorNode -
createWaveShaper(
) → WaveShaperNode -
decodeAudioData(
) → AudioBuffer -
noSuchMethod(
Invocation invocation) → dynamic -
Invoked when a nonexistent method or property is accessed.
inherited
-
resume(
) → dynamic -
suspend(
) → dynamic -
toString(
) → String -
A string representation of this object.
inherited
Operators
-
operator ==(
Object other) → bool -
The equality operator.
inherited